    Talon spike not staying in

    One of my Talon spikes is not staying attached, it comes right out,

    I had to take off my talon from the bracket in order to move the boat in the water.

    It looks like the o'ring is damaged, but is that what holds it in,

    I believe if I get a new o'ring and slide it back in it will hold??

    not sure what the next step would be,...

    I can see how to replace a spike requires popping out pins adding a new o'ring

    its an 8ft 1st gen model

    The O-ring does not hold the spike up. It is the wrap drum that does that. It could be the the torq spring in side of the wrap drum could be broken. Other than that does the wrap drum make any clicking noise when it is operating from the deployed position?
